Marella Celebration has become a casualty of the Coronavirus pandemic and is being retired a year ahead of schedule. TUI, parent company of ship operator Marella Cruises, said the 1,250-passenger ship, built in 1984, had become “one of the longest standing and most loved ships in the fleet”.
